Thank you very much for purchasing
this Anemo-Psychrometer.
This unique meter design with 7 H.V.A.C
&R must parameters in 1. The meter
designed as battery operated for Humidity
,Air temp., Dew Point, Wet Bulb, Air
Velocity, Air Volume & BTU (8912).
The sensor is built in the remote fan and
is specially protected by tunable cap.
While in operation, please turn on the cap
to get accurate temperature and humidity
reading.
The psychrometer is a micro processor-
based design. A must device for HVAC
engineers use. No need to whirl the
meter or refer to the chart. Easy to get
wet bulb, dew point and BTU(8912)
quickly!

KEY PAD
1.Power :
-Turn on the meter with auto-sleep mode.
-Turn off the meter at any mode.
-When the meter is off, pressing more
than two sec. to enter units selection.
2.MODE:
-Pressing to select different modes.
Temp. DP WB RH Velocity.
-Pressing longer to select VOL and CAP.
3.ENTER:
- To confirm the setting & calibration.
4.Mx/Mn/Up :
-Pressing to view MAX/MIN/AVG value.
-Press to select the value of each digit
in cycle.
5.REC/START:
- In velocity mode, pressing this key to
store the current velocity reading into
memory (8911only)
- To start measuring volume or capacity
(8912 only) without waiting.
www.GlobalTestSupply.com
Find Quality Products Online at: sales@GlobalTestSupply.com
All manuals and user guides at all-guides.com
4
6.HOLD/Down :
- In basic modes pressing this key to
hold the current reading, then pressing
this key again to unlock the holding.
- Pressing to select the setting digit.
7.Power + :
- When the meter is off, pressing more
than two sec. to enter non-sleep mode.
8.Power + + :
- Pressing more than two seconds to
enter RH calibration mode.
9.ENTER+ :
- Pressing to turn on/off the backlight.

POWER ON/OFF & UNIT SELECT
Press to turn on the meter with
auto-sleep mode. Press again to turn
off the meter at any mode.
Or
cm inch
When in unit selection mode, press
or to select the unit, then,
press to save and meter will be
powered on automatically.
When the meter is off, pressing
more than two seconds to enter units
selection mode.

After starting measuring the volume,
the meter will automatically count the
volume for 60 seconds to give a average
value. (Fig. J) During this 60 second
time, the vane should move along the
whole outlet to cover each area so the
measured data could be more accuracy.
The count down number displayed on
the top- left corner as a reminder and
meter also beeps when 60 sec is up.
